The Middle East & Africa generic drugs market size is expected to reach US$ 35,795.50 million by 2031 from US$ 28,684.12 million in 2024. The market is estimated to record a CAGR of 3.2% from 2025 to 2031.
Executive Summary and Middle East & Africa Generic Drugs Market Analysis:The Middle East and Africa (MEA) generic drugs market is experiencing significant growth driven by improved healthcare infrastructure, rising demand for affordable treatments, and an increasing prevalence of chronic diseases such as diabetes, cardiovascular disorders, cancer, and infectious diseases, including malaria, HIV/AIDS, and tuberculosis. Countries such as Saudi Arabia, the UAE, and South Africa are witnessing heightened demand for generic drugs due to the aging population and rising life expectancy, as per the Ageing in the Middle-East and North Africa, with the elderly expected to form the largest age group by 2050 in MENA. Government initiatives promoting cost-effective healthcare solutions, centralized drug procurement, and price control policies are supporting generic drug adoption across the region. Local pharmaceutical manufacturing is expanding in countries including Egypt, Jordan, and South Africa, helping reduce import dependency and enhance regional drug security. International collaborations and public-private partnerships are further fueling innovation and the production of complex generics and biosimilars, positioning MEA as a key region for utilizing generic pharmaceuticals. The growing awareness about preventive healthcare and the increasing number of health insurance schemes are contributing to higher accessibility of medications. Regulatory reforms and faster drug approval processes are enabling quicker market entry for generic drug producers. Companies are also investing in digital transformation, logistics infrastructure, and cold chain networks to improve last-mile delivery and product quality.

According to Living Media India Limited 2025, the expiration of patents on branded drugs significantly drives the pharmaceutical generic drug market. Generic manufacturers can produce and sell bioequivalent versions at significantly lower prices after the patent expiry, creating vast market opportunities. For instance, in 2025-26, key drugs such as Keytruda (developed by Merck for cancer immunotherapy), which generated over US$ 25 billion in sales in 2024, and Ozempic (produced by Novo Nordisk for diabetes and anti-obesity treatment), are set to lose their patents. This initiative will develop new opportunities for generic pharmaceuticals and biosimilars. Other high-revenue drugs, such as Eliquis (Bristol-Myers Squibb's blood thinner) and Cosentyx (Novartis' immunology drug), will face similar patent expirations, further expanding the opportunity for generics.
Several blockbuster drugs are expected to lose their patents in 2024, creating even more space for generic alternatives. Notable drugs include:
- Abilify Maintaina (Otsuka Pharmaceutical), an injectable antipsychotic with US$ 15.5 billion in sales in 2022, is set to lose its patent by October 2024.
- Xarelto (Janssen Pharmaceuticals), a leading anticoagulant, is scheduled to lose its patent in August 2024.
- Farxiga (AstraZeneca), a blockbuster anti-diabetic drug generating ~US$ 4.3 billion annually, will lose its patent in 2024.
- Lynparza (AstraZeneca), used in cancer treatment, with sales of ~US$ 2.7 billion, is also set to lose its patent in 2024.
- Symbicort (AstraZeneca), a respiratory drug, will lose its patent in November 2024.
- Entresto (Novartis), a heart failure treatment generating US$ 2.5 billion in 2022, will lose its patent in May 2024.
- Latuda (Sunovion Pharmaceuticals), an antipsychotic with US$ 1.8 billion in sales, will lose its patent in February 2024.
- Xifaxan (Salix Pharmaceuticals), a gastrointestinal drug with sales of US$ 1.6 billion, will lose its patent in June 2024.
- Cabometyx (Exelixis), used to treat advanced renal cell carcinoma, will lose its patent in September 2024.
These pharmaceuticals collectively generated substantial global revenue and created opportunities for generic manufacturers to develop more cost-effective alternatives. Between 2023 and 2029, patents for over 100 critical drugs, including cancer, diabetes, and cardiovascular drugs, will expire, accounting for more than US$ 300 billion in global annual sales. This loss of exclusivity will significantly expand the market share for generics and biosimilars, reducing healthcare costs worldwide. The influx of generics is expected to reshape the global pharmaceutical landscape by providing more affordable treatment options.
The expiration of patents for high-revenue drugs is anticipated to drive a shift in market dynamics, increasing the affordability and accessibility of healthcare. According to The Indian Express Ltd., 2025, the expiration of patents for these blockbuster drugs will create a surge in generics and biosimilars, providing a substantial growth opportunity for generic drug manufacturers.
Middle East & Africa Generic Drugs Market Country InsightsBased on country, the Middle East & Africa generic drugs market comprises Saudi Arabia, South Africa, the UAE, and the Rest of Middle East & Africa. South Africa held the largest share in 2024.
South Africa's generic drugs market is witnessing significant momentum, driven by structural reforms in healthcare, government initiatives, and the need for affordable medication. With a GDP of USUS$ 377.78 billion in 2023, healthcare represented approximately 8.5% of the national GDP-marking it as the second-largest share among sectors. The country is investing in healthcare infrastructure to address key health challenges such as HIV/AIDS, tuberculosis, cancer, and other non-communicable diseases. As per the International Trade Administration (ITA), total prescription drug sales in South Africa amounted to USUS$ 4.514 billion in 2022, of which generic drugs accounted for USUS$ 2.059 billion, indicating a preference for cost-effective treatment options. South Africa's public healthcare system serves nearly 80% of the population, and generics play a vital role in expanding access to essential medicines amid budget constraints. The local market is supported by government-led initiatives such as the National Health Insurance (NHI) scheme, which promotes the use of generics to reduce pharmaceutical expenditure. According to GLOBOCAN 2022 data, 120,226 new cancer cases and 69,874 cancer-related deaths were recorded, underscoring the urgent need for enhanced therapeutic access. The prevalence of chronic diseases such as diabetes and cardiovascular disorders is rising, driven by lifestyle changes and urbanization. In response, South Africa is fostering local pharmaceutical manufacturing, offering incentives to generic drug producers, and simplifying regulatory approval through agencies such as SAHPRA (South African Health Products Regulatory Authority). International pharmaceutical companies are also partnering with local players to boost generic drug availability and reduce import dependency.
